Senior Backend Developer (Kotlin/Java) (Visa and work permit sponsorship to Thailand)

AnyMind Group

  • Bangkok
  • Permanent
  • Full-time
  • 1 month ago
Join AnyMind Group's Tech Team as a Senior Backend (Kotlin) Developer and play a key role in building the future of our multi-channel e-commerce platform. Based in our Bangkok office, you'll focus on enhancing AnyX (a comprehensive e-commerce management platform), developing and improving the AnyX/AnyLogi components, which are essential for product, order, and logistics management for clients across 24 locations in 15 markets. This is your chance to make a tangible difference in the world of e-commerce innovation.What You'll Do
  • Design and develop new features for AnyX/AnyLogi components, following coding standards.
  • Understand specifications provided by the Product Manager and apply them to domain-driven design codebases.
  • Lead discussion about which domain logic is better for the business within the engineering team.
  • Deliver products from development to production fast speed and high-quality.
  • Communicate closely with Product management and Engineers to further improve product quality.
  • Participate in product operation tasks, including monitoring, troubleshooting, and supporting the stable operation of the product.
Who You Are
  • 3+ years of experience in Kotlin/Java back-end development
  • Experience in system maintenance and operation for at least 2 year
  • Excellent experience working with Spring Framework / Ktor and any cloud service of Google Cloud/AWS/Azure
  • Professional in domain-driven design, clean architecture, and microservices
  • Speak business-level English
Nice To Have
  • Good knowledge of Google Cloud
  • Experience in creating product requirements and definitions
  • Experience with DevOps, Scrum/Agile methodologies
  • Good knowledge of e-commerce or logistics business (especially multi-channel or warehouse/fulfillment operations)
  • Experience with Go language (some subsystems are implemented in Go and are being migrated to Kotlin, so Go experience is helpful)
Tools We Use
  • Language: Kotlin 2.1+
  • Framework: Spring Boot, GraphQL, gRPC
  • DB: PostgreSQL
  • Version control: Git
  • Repositories: BitBucket
  • Infrastructure: Google Cloud Platform (GKE, Cloud Run, CloudSQL, GCS, Pub/Sub)
  • Server monitoring: Cloud Logging, Sentry
  • CI/CD: Bitbucket Pipeline
  • Communication tool: Slack
  • Project management: JIRA with Agile Board
  • Document/Requirement management: Confluence
  • AI Tools: OpenAI, Gemini, Code Rabbit (currently in a trial phase; we are exploring best practices for effective use)
Why You'll Love It
  • Advanced AI Tools For All Positions!!
  • Creative office at Emporium (located at BTS Phrom Phong)
  • Work hard, play harder office
  • Competitive Salary
  • Performance Review (2 times per year)
  • Performance Bonus (1 time per year)
  • Annual Paid Leave
  • Compassionate Leave
  • Health Insurance
  • Social Security
  • Discount for Fitness Gym at EmQuartier
  • Monthly Birthday Celebration
  • Monthly, Quarterly, Annual MVP Awards (prizes up to 8,000USD)
  • Work in professional and dynamic environment
  • Good chance to explore new trends in a digital market
  • Opportunity to learn most advanced advertising technology platforms
For Whom is Applicable for Relocation
  • Visa and work permit sponsorship
  • Flight ticket one round to from your home country to Bangkok
  • Family visa support after 3 months
  • Hotel room for the first 2 weeks.

AnyMind Group